Belly Up, the Story of Penn Square Bank, by Philip Zweig, Ballentine Books, 1986

Review: Wall Street Journal reporter Zweig details how the Oklahoma City Penn Square Bank went under. PW recommended Mark Singer’s account of the same events in Funny Money unless “the reader’s appetite is for unembellished facts, presented in plain prose, of events that are of themselves exciting.”

– Publishers Weekly
